你查询的IP:[116.4.85.111]  地理位置:中国–广东–东莞

最新查询210.2.112.4 123.244.129.214 222.64.145.194 116.192.169.62 123.138.16.46 118.239.24.157 221.196.202.183 121.76.111.131 124.196.92.9 116.4.85.111 118.66.61.243 202.74.8.117 210.14.128.79 203.128.32.169 210.51.236.97 159.226.102.65 218.56.130.22 210.25.227.166 121.255.174.165 119.42.7.87 125.112.73.197 221.200.241.124 202.122.128.189 202.153.48.222 202.165.96.29 119.128.135.103 118.102.16.229 123.171.128.108 202.143.16.242 124.14.130.72 203.88.32.46